Jetez un œil à la vie traditionnelle d'un chien de traîneau dans l'intérieur de l'Alaska. La lignée de ces chiens remonte à l’époque où les premiers peuples autochtones d’Alaska et Inuits habitaient l’Arctique. Nous avons également des chiens des régions arctiques du Canada et du Groenland et promouvons le mode de vie de subsistance de ces cultures arctiques. Ces chiens vous montreront ce pour quoi ils sont nés et ont été élevés en tant qu'animaux de somme, tandis que nous avons veillé à leurs soins au cours des siècles passés, en préservant cet héritage. Soyez témoin de l'enthousiasme absolu de ces chiens pour faire ce qu'ils aiment !

Sorry the tour did not meet your expectations. It is advertised appropriately stating ATVs are used. Motor assist is used in temperatures above 40F with almost every ethical sleddog kennel during the summer tourist season, so the dogs do not overheat.
